Currently, the opkg-key utility calls gpg with --no-options,
which uses /dev/null as the configuration file. This means
any configurations in /etc/opkg/gpg/gpg.conf were being
ignored. This change applies a patch to remove the
--no-options flag.

Opkg 0.6.1 Changes:
- Opkg will no longer complain when trying to clean up the temporary
  directory, if the directory does not exist.
- Fixed a SEGFAULT when parsing package indexes with invalid `Size` or
  `Installed-Size` fields. These indexes will now produce a
  comprehensible error.
- Fixed an inconsistecy in .list generation where files would sometimes
  be entered with/without a trailing slash. The trailng slash should now
  always be removed.
- Fixed [a bug](https://bugzilla.yoctoproject.org/show_bug.cgi?id=10461)
  in package removal, where empty common directories would be left on
  disk, even after all owning packages were removed.

Distros can customize the location of OPKG data using OPKGLIBDIR.  In
OE-Core commit 11f1956cf5d7 ("package_manager.py: define info_dir and
status_file when OPKGLIBDIR isn't the default"), a fix was applied to
correctly set the info_dir and status_file options relative to
OPKGLIBDIR.

However, as the commit message notes, the opkg.conf file deployed as
part of the opkg package must also be adjusted to correctly reflect the
changed location.  Otherwise, opkg running inside the image cannot find
its data.

Fix this by also setting the info_dir and status_file options in
opkg.conf to the correct location relative to OPKGLIBDIR.

This allows the use of zstd for opkg packages by using OPKGBUILDCMD:
OPKGBUILDCMD = "opkg-build -Z zstd"
